1. The Growth of Mobile Gaming
Mobile gaming has been a dominant trend in Asia, as the majority of players prefer accessing their favorite casino games through smartphones and tablets. The penetration of high-speed internet and the widespread availability of affordable mobile devices have made it accessible to a broad audience. According to recent studies, around 50% of global online gambling revenue now comes from mobile platforms, and this percentage is even higher in Asia.
2. Live Dealer Games: Bridging the Gap
Live dealer games have gained immense popularity among Asian players who seek a more immersive experience. Live dealer games offer players the opportunity to interact with real dealers through live video streaming, providing a thrilling casino atmosphere from the comfort of their homes. This trend has led to the growth of online casinos offering a wide variety of live games, including baccarat, blackjack, and roulette.
3. Cryptocurrency and Blockchain Technology
The rise of cryptocurrencies has also impacted the online casino market in Asia. C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and others are increasingly used for deposits and withdrawals, attracting players with their anonymity and low transaction fees. Additionally, the use of blockchain technology enhances transparency and fairness, which are crucial factors for players when choosing an online casino.
4. Focus on Regulatory Compliance
With the rapid growth of online gambling in Asia, regulatory frameworks are adapting to ensure safer gambling environments. Countries like Japan and the Philippines have started implementing stricter regulations to manage online gambling operators and protect players. This shift is essential for building trust between operators and players, and it is likely that other Asian countries will follow suit to create robust regulatory structures.

7. Diverse Game Offerings
Asian players have diverse preferences when it comes to gaming. Traditional games such as Mahjong, Pai Gow, and Sic Bo are seeing a resurgence as online versions become widely available. Casinos are working hard to cater to these preferences by providing a mix of traditional and modern games to attract a broader audience.
